Cardboard box reuse

Sadlers specialises in implementing cardboard box reuse schemes across the country.

In one instance the company acquired used boxes which had contained plastic bottles that were supplied to a large household products manufacturer. After a site visit Sadlers recommended a segregation method which returned a three-fold increase in revenue for the producer with very little extra effort.

In another example, a food manufacturer had a problem disposing of corrugated Octabins. They were simply too big to fit their baler so they were paying a contractor to dispose of them. Sadlers created a reuse market which saved disposal costs and produced a substantial revenue stream for the producer.
